L1 Visa Delhi Things To Know Before You Buy Table of ContentsAn Unbiased View of L1 Visa DelhiL1 Visa Delhi for DummiesSome Known Questions About L1 Visa Delhi.L1 Visa Delhi Can Be Fun For EveryoneThe smart Trick of L1 Visa Delhi That Nobody is Talking AboutGetting My L1 Visa Delhi https://edwinymfuj.sunderwiki.com/1725136/l1_visa_delhi_the_facts